Summary
This analysis by John M. Anderson examines how Gemini's stock has fallen below its IPO levels amid a broader cryptocurrency market downturn.
The article explores the challenges facing Gemini, the cryptocurrency exchange founded by the Winklevoss twins, as its stock price drops below initial public offering levels. Anderson analyzes how market volatility, regulatory pressures, and increased competition have contributed to declining performance across the crypto sector. The piece examines broader economic factors affecting digital asset investments, including changing institutional sentiment and global monetary policies that have shifted investor focus toward traditional assets.
